The status above is computed from the cited rows below: independent recommendations can support a fire-resistant result, an avoid row can produce keep-away, and disagreement stays visible as conflict. Placement notes preserve each source’s own scheme rather than translating unlike rules into one scale. This is evidence about a plant, not permission to plant it in every part of the defensible space; Zone 0 remains noncombustible.
These are exact U.S. botanical-area records from the cited range source. Native and introduced describe biogeographic relationship, not fire performance or planting approval. Doubtful and extinct rows stay visible but do not count as current presence.
